Entrypoint

Docker-compose override entrypoint

Docker-compose override entrypoint
  1. Bolehkah saya mengatasi titik entri docker?
  2. Adakah Docker mengarang entrypoint mengatasi titik entri dockerfile?
  3. Apa gunanya Docker mengarang mengatasi?
  4. Adakah perintah mengatasi titik masuk?
  5. Cara Mengatasi Kemasukan dan CMD di Docker?
  6. Apa yang mengatasi titik entri lalai gambar kontena?
  7. Sekiranya saya menggunakan Cmd atau Entrypoint untuk Docker?
  8. Adakah entrypoint selalu berjalan?
  9. Apakah titik entri di docker mengarang fail?
  10. Bolehkah saya mempunyai Dockerfile tanpa entrypoint?
  11. Adakah entrypoint wajib dalam dockerfile?
  12. Bagaimana anda menimpa titik masuk di Kubernetes?
  13. Apakah perbezaan antara entrypoint dan cmd di docker?
  14. Adakah entrypoint selalu berjalan?
  15. Adakah Kubectl memohon ganti?
  16. Adakah kubernet menggunakan titik entri docker?

Bolehkah saya mengatasi titik entri docker?

Perbezaan utama antara CMD dan EntryPoint ialah anda boleh mengatasi arahan CMD dari Docker CLI apabila bekas sedang berjalan. Walau bagaimanapun, anda tidak boleh mengatasi perintah entrypoint dengan hanya parameter baris arahan. Sebaliknya, anda perlu menggunakan arahan Docker Run dengan sintaks tertentu.

Adakah Docker mengarang entrypoint mengatasi titik entri dockerfile?

NOTA: Menetapkan Point EntroPoint Kedua -duanya mengatasi sebarang titik entri lalai yang ditetapkan pada imej Perkhidmatan dengan arahan Dockerfile EntryPoint, dan membersihkan sebarang arahan lalai pada imej - yang bermaksud bahawa jika terdapat arahan CMD dalam fail docker, ia tidak diendahkan.

Apa gunanya Docker mengarang mengatasi?

Docker-compose. mengatasi. YML adalah fail konfigurasi di mana anda boleh mengatasi tetapan sedia ada dari docker-compose. YML atau bahkan menambah perkhidmatan baru.

Adakah perintah mengatasi titik masuk?

Ia digunakan untuk menetapkan executable yang akan dijalankan hanya apabila bekas dimulakan. Perintah EntryPoint tidak dapat ditindih atau diabaikan walaupun argumen baris arahan dinyatakan. Ini boleh ditulis dalam bentuk eksekutif dan shell.

Cara Mengatasi Kemasukan dan CMD di Docker?

Sebagai pengendali (orang yang menjalankan bekas dari imej), anda boleh mengatasi CMD hanya dengan menentukan arahan baru. Sekiranya imej juga menentukan titik masuk maka CMD atau perintah akan dilampirkan sebagai argumen ke titik masuk. Jadi untuk melakukan apa yang anda mahukan, anda hanya perlu menentukan CMD, dan mengatasi menggunakan /bin /bash .

Apa yang mengatasi titik entri lalai gambar kontena?

Sekiranya anda ingin mengatasi argumen entri titik lalai imej dan perintah, anda boleh menggunakan medan arahan dan args dalam konfigurasi kontena. Medan arahan menentukan arahan sebenar yang dikendalikan oleh bekas. Bidang ARGS menentukan hujah -hujah yang diserahkan kepada perintah itu.

Sekiranya saya menggunakan Cmd atau Entrypoint untuk Docker?

Arahan entrypoint kelihatan hampir serupa dengan arahan CMD. Walau bagaimanapun, perbezaan utama yang menonjol di antara mereka adalah bahawa ia tidak akan mengabaikan mana -mana parameter yang telah anda tentukan dalam arahan Docker Run (parameter CLI).

Adakah entrypoint selalu berjalan?

Arahan EntryPoint boleh digunakan untuk kedua-dua imej docker tujuan tunggal dan multi-mod di mana anda mahu arahan khusus untuk dijalankan pada permulaan kontena. Anda juga boleh menggunakannya untuk membina imej kontena pembalut yang merangkumi program warisan untuk kontena, memastikan program itu akan sentiasa dijalankan.

Apakah titik entri di docker mengarang fail?

Gambaran Keseluruhan. Dalam fail Docker, kami menggunakan arahan entrypoint untuk menyediakan executable yang akan sentiasa dilaksanakan apabila bekas dilancarkan. Tidak seperti arahan CMD, walaupun bekas berjalan dengan parameter baris arahan yang ditentukan, arahan entrypoint tidak dapat diabaikan atau ditindih.

Bolehkah saya mempunyai Dockerfile tanpa entrypoint?

Mana -mana imej Docker mesti mempunyai pengisytiharan entrypoint atau CMD untuk bekas untuk memulakan. Walaupun arahan entrypoint dan cmd mungkin kelihatan serupa pada pandangan pertama, terdapat perbezaan asas bagaimana mereka membina imej kontena. (Ini adalah sebahagian daripada Panduan Docker kami.

Adakah entrypoint wajib dalam dockerfile?

Lebih suka entrypoint ke cmd semasa membina imej docker yang boleh dilaksanakan dan anda memerlukan arahan yang sentiasa dilaksanakan. Di samping.

Bagaimana anda menimpa titik masuk di Kubernetes?

Di Kubernet, semasa menentukan bekas, anda boleh memilih untuk mengatasi kedua -dua entrypoint dan CMD . Untuk berbuat demikian, anda menetapkan perintah sifat dan args dalam spesifikasi kontena, seperti yang ditunjukkan dalam penyenaraian berikut.

Apakah perbezaan antara entrypoint dan cmd di docker?

CMD: Menetapkan parameter lalai yang boleh ditindih dari antara muka baris arahan docker (CLI) semasa menjalankan bekas Docker. Kemasukan: Menetapkan parameter lalai yang tidak dapat ditindih semasa melaksanakan bekas docker dengan parameter CLI.

Adakah entrypoint selalu berjalan?

Arahan EntryPoint boleh digunakan untuk kedua-dua imej docker tujuan tunggal dan multi-mod di mana anda mahu arahan khusus untuk dijalankan pada permulaan kontena. Anda juga boleh menggunakannya untuk membina imej kontena pembalut yang merangkumi program warisan untuk kontena, memastikan program itu akan sentiasa dijalankan.

Adakah Kubectl memohon ganti?

Kemudian, anda boleh menggunakan Kubectl Apply untuk menolak perubahan konfigurasi anda ke kluster. Perintah ini akan membandingkan versi konfigurasi yang anda tolak dengan versi terdahulu dan menggunakan perubahan yang telah anda buat, tanpa menulis ganti sebarang perubahan automatik kepada sifat yang belum anda tentukan.

Adakah kubernet menggunakan titik entri docker?

Titik Kemasukan dan Argumen Kontena

Imej Docker mempunyai metadata yang merangkumi titik entri lalai dan cmd lalai. Apabila Kubernet memulakan bekas, ia menjalankan entri entri lalai imej dan melepasi cmd lalai imej sebagai argumen.

Cara Mengkonfigurasi Output untuk Fasih-Bit Custom untuk bekerja dengan GKE?
Bagaimana fluentbit mengumpul log?Apakah perbezaan antara Fluentbit dan Fluentd? Bagaimana fluentbit mengumpul log?Bit fasih mengumpul log dari pelb...
CICD AWS Secrets Manager - Cara Menentukan Rahsia Yang Akan Suntikan?
Bagaimana saya membaca Rahsia dari Pengurus Rahsia AWS?Rahsia jenis mana yang biasanya disimpan dengan Pengurus Rahsia?Bagaimana saya menyenaraikan r...
Bagaimana saya menyediakan fail konfigurasi (.env) semasa memulakan bekas?
Adalah .env file config?Adakah penggunaan Docker .fail env?Bagaimana saya membuat .fail atau kod env?Adakah anda melakukan .fail env?Di mana saya mel...